DESIGN & COMFORT:

Logitech G502 Lightspeed

While you looking at it, you still had those same 11 Grimble buttons, the illuminated G logo, the DPI light indicators. At first glance, you might not even notice anything different at all. There’s the same design, same ergonomic and that’s what we loved about the G502.

When you compare this with the G502 Hero, the size and shapes will remain unchanged, same button layout but there is one slightly noticeable change which is the hyper scroll wheel. This now has a rubber accent on the wheel itself for improved grip and it’s also more of a hallowed wheel as opposed to the more solid metal piece on the previous mice. Still feels the same and still works, you just now have that rubber coating and it’s also gonna help slightly cut down in the overall weight.

It is lighter than G502 Hero. This is 114 grams versus the Hero is 121 grams, so not by much but it is still lighter and they managed to rework the entire internals and so cut down a few grams while still integrating the battery and the wireless technology. However, it’s actually a lot lighter than you might think. So with the entire internal redesign making this possible, it feels significantly lighter. It may only be 7 grams on paper but it was noticeable that the fact we no longer had the added weight of the cable which wasn’t included in the masses overall weight before, that was an additional 40 grams bringing the total weight of the G502 Hero 261 grams versus now 114 grams on the Lightspeed, that’s definitely gonna be a lot more apparent now.

The extra change is you can add if you want to by the additional 16 grams from the optional weight set on the bottom of the mouse but probably not. There’s still the cutout in their sensor, we can put in for weights and then you can also put two weights in the little module on the bottom which is removable you can plug them in there and add some weight to the bottom of the mouse.

FEATURES & PERFORMANCE:

Logitech G502 Lightspeed

Getting this powered on, working is as simple as turning on the power switch on the bottom then, you have two options for connectivity. On the bottom, there is also a spot for the removable power plate module and the bottom cover comes off where you could still take out these up with those optional weight sets. The cable used to be now has a micro USB slot for charging or you can just plug this in and use it wired if you want but uh don’t do that, the whole purpose is of the wireless mouse.

A braided cable is included inside the box for you. For those weights, it comes with this little carrying case inside here are the six weights. There are four two gram ones and two four-gram weights of the USB receiver in here and a USB extension plug.

The Hero sensor returns with the 100 to 16000 dpi capabilities. You have the adjustable report rate from 125 Hertz to 1,000 Hertz at one millisecond response time. The 32-bit ARM processor also allows for on-board storage, so if you bring this with you somewhere you’re gonna have your dpi settings or profiles and lighting all saved onto the mouse itself.

When I started playing with it, I had zero issues transitioning obviously. I got all my previous data from like the DPI settings, put them on here so it all matched and everything was with no issues. It’s been really great, very smooth, and it does feel lighter just not having that extra 40 grams of the cable on here, it’s gonna be immediately noticeable when you start gaming with this.

Logitech G903 Lightspeed

The G903 comes with up to 11 keys depending on how you set it up. They did that to let gamers set up the mouse for either their left or right hand. You can even make it have full side buttons if you love having a lot of buttons on your mouse but I think, this is a little bit overkill.

There are basic buttons to adjust the G903 dpi and switch between a smooth or step action on its wheel also the usual left and right controls. I found to be very useful about this mouse is that it lets you adjust the mouse’s wheel action, you can use the resistance-free mode to scroll through web pages faster and you can switch back when you’re gaming or doing something else which doesn’t require scrolling.

The mouse itself uses the PMW 3366 sensor which is one of the most accurate and precise sensors out there with a minimum sensitivity of 200 dpi and a maximum sensitivity of 12,000 dpi.

CONNECTIVITY OPTIONS:

Logitech G502 Lightspeed

Option one for connectivity is just using this USB with that receiver, you plug it into any available USB slot on your PC and it’ll pair automatically. The second is with the power play. Logitech has their power play mouse pad from 2017 and this essentially when paired with the G502 Lightspeed gives you endless power and battery life and then no need to use that USB receiver. So, good news for current power play users if you have the mouse pad or a current compatible Mouse, you can just essentially plug this into your PC and then once you have the power play module, you put it on the bottom of your mouse.

Then whenever you use this with the power play mouse pad, it’ll just automatically pair and connect for you. So, you don’t have to also have the USB receiver for the G502 Lightspeed and then also it’ll just be charging your mouse whenever you’re not using it, it’s the friction so whenever it’s on the surface of the powerplay mouse pad, your mouse will be charged. So, you can never run out of battery essentially.

Logitech G903 Lightspeed

If you’re using the G903 as a normal wireless mouse, you use the same USB dongle that Logitech is used on its other wireless devices for a few years now. On the other hand, if you’re using the G903 with power-play the mouse pad itself acts as your wireless receiver.

The performance is great in both cases and I can confidently say that you can easily compare this Mouse to a wired mouse and won’t notice any difference in polling rate, latency, or response time. It’s pretty much indistinguishable from any wide mouse I’ve ever used before.

BATTERY:

Logitech G502 Lightspeed

The battery life over USB without the power play is pretty damn impressive. You get 48 hours with the default RGB lighting and around 60 hours with no lights on. So, you can mess around with it, keep it simple like a static color maybe at half brightness, you’ll get it at around 50 plus hours. This lasts around a week depending on your gaming session.

Logitech G903 Lightspeed

One of the most annoying things about wireless mice is that you have to charge them very often. You won’t have that problem with the Logitech G903 because Logitech claims that the battery life can last for up to 30 hours depending on how you use it.

According to our tests, this was somewhat accurate and we think that it was more than enough since we put it to charge when we go to sleep anyway.

The Logitech G903’s newest feature is that it comes with the ability to wirelessly charge through a specialized mousepad called the Logitech power play. The pad essentially creates an electromagnetic resonance charging field which the mouse absorbs through a Power Core module that you can attach to the bottom of the mouse. This means that the mouse itself can pull enough electricity that the mouse can keep on going without you having to charge it. Not only that but it can even fully charge the mouse with battery in about 14 hours, this is great news for gamers since they don’t have to leave a chair anymore.

SOFTWARE:

Logitech G502 Lightspeed

We have the G Hub software and first is the lighting tab for picking your effects and the colors. You can do this for both the G logo and the DPI lights or sync them together or sync them with other Logitech G products. Next is the assignment tab or changing up the 11 programmable buttons anything from commands, keys, actions, macro-system controls, all that stuff.

You can also then go in and enable the G shift which is essentially like having a secondary command for these buttons on your mouse. Then, there is a DPI tab for customizing the five onboard DPI settings, easily adjust the speeds, and the report right there. You’ll notice up top, you can also have different profiles like for individual games and even some have their own like lighting integrations but light sync but this is G Hub, you’ve seen it before probably.

WHICH TO BUY?

Both the mouse is pretty similar but there are some major changes. If you’re right-handed then the G502 will be great to buy because in my opinion it’s better as a package, there fewer features comparatively but G502 costs $40 less than G903 but if you have more money to spend then you can give a try on G903 lightspeed. If you’re left-handed then definitely G903 will be good for you.
